Key Responsibilities

We are looking for an Account Executive with a least 1-year experience in luxury travel.

The Account Executive’s role is to assist the Account Managers and Directors in the day to day running of their accounts. You will need to be proactive, organised, flexible and have determination and enthusiasm. You must be able to work well as part of a team but also show your own initiative with the ability to work under pressure.

In terms of your “day to day” duties specifically, you will be expected:



- To help in the organisation of press functions and press trips

- To attend such functions and escort press trips as dictated by the Account Director

- Build strong relationships and networks with colleagues, clients and the media

- To research any third-party information and industry reports on behalf of clients

- Undertake research for new business proposals

- To help with ideas and information, contributing to the success and smooth running of the individual client campaigns

- To be responsible for the press cuttings resulting from our work for our clients - an important and often under-rated role

- To be responsible for the forward features planning and pitching on behalf of our clients

- To write and help distribute press releases on behalf of our clients as well as preparing media lists

- To evaluate and operate our filing systems

- To maintain stocks of / photocopy as required, update press kits on behalf of our clients

- To be in charge of our stationery and brochure material on behalf of our clients, re-ordering as required

- Ensure that team client data / activity and coverage is added to the PRCO ATS reporting system on a regular basis with report’s ready for distribution by the 5th of the month following the due date

- To help and take on special projects such as press releases, newsletters, regional press functions, etc. as dictated by the Account Director

- To assist and contribute to our company social media channels on a regular basis

- To assist and contribute to our company blog on a regular basis

- Liaison with our offices in Paris, Milan, Moscow, Munich and Dubai as applicable

- Any other works as dictated by the Directors.
